Welcome to Down the Road Guesthouse, your perfect base for exploring the Bay of Fundy’s highest tides in the world.

Located just minutes from the Rocks Provincial Park, our historic five bedroom, two bath home has been in our family for more than 150 years, longer than Canada has been a country. It was completely renovated in 2017 while keeping the country character of the home. The property is large, with plenty of space inside and out, all within walking distance of the Bay of Fundy.

Neighbourhood highlights

The best part of the area is that it sits between two beautiful nature parks. The Hopewell Rocks Provincial Park is just a few minutes away while Fundy National Park is about a half-hour down a scenic country highway.

For outdoor lovers, hiking, swimming, zip lining, kayaking and some of the most dramatic views on Canada’s east coast are just around the corner.

There are also several small museums in the area including a historic jail and courthouse.

Moncton, the hub of Canada’s Maritime region, is a short drive away, with an international airport, fine dining and some of the best shopping in the Atlantic region.

The nearby Village of Hillsborough features a small selection of groceries, gas, and restaurants, while Alma, (30 km or 18 miles away) is the gateway to Fundy Park, with some of the best seafood our region has to offer. This is another great spot to see the power of tides.

The home is about a three-hour drive from the Maine border, two hours from Saint John, one hour from Nova Scotia and about 90 minutes from Prince Edward Island, meaning you could see all three Maritime provinces in one long day trip.
